#0be543 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0be543 is composed of 4.3% red, 89.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 135.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#0be543 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ff86 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#0be543 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0be543 has RGB values of R:11, G:229,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 779587.

Shades and Tints of #0be543
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f1f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0be543
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717f74 is the less saturated color, while #02ee3f is the most saturated one.
